TAYLOR, Presiding Judge.
The appellant, Sandra Siegel, was convicted of driving under the influence of alcohol (DUI), a violation of § 32-5A-191(a)(2), Code of Alabama 1975. She was sentenced to 30 days in jail, 27 of which were suspended and she was placed on 2 years supervised probation.
